    What Makes a Welcoming Environment?

    Creating a welcoming environment can have a profound impact on the well-being and success of individuals in any space, whether it’s a workplace, community center, or even a home. A welcoming environment invites people to feel safe, valued, and comfortable, which fosters inclusivity, productivity, and positive interactions. Here are some key elements that contribute to making a space truly welcoming.

    1. Warm and Inviting Physical Space

    The physical appearance of a space is often the first impression people have, so it’s important to create a setting that feels warm and inviting. This can be achieved through thoughtful design elements like comfortable seating, ample natural lighting, and visually appealing decor. Plants, artwork, and calming colors like greens and blues can all add to a space’s warmth and make people feel at ease. Temperature control, good ventilation, and a layout that allows for easy navigation also play a role in ensuring physical comfort for everyone.     2. Accessibility for All

    A welcoming environment is accessible to everyone, regardless of physical abilities. This means ensuring spaces are wheelchair-accessible with ramps, elevators, and wide doorways as needed. But accessibility goes beyond physical space: it includes making accommodations for those with sensory or cognitive needs. For instance, providing clear, easy-to-read signage, quiet areas, and assistive technology when necessary shows thoughtfulness towards a wide range of visitors. Accessibility also includes being mindful of language differences by offering multilingual support or translation services, ensuring people feel valued and included.

    3. Positive Interpersonal Interactions

    Nothing makes a space more welcoming than positive, respectful interactions. Friendly greetings, smiles, and active listening all make individuals feel recognized and valued. Staff or hosts in welcoming environments should be trained in communication skills, including non-verbal cues like eye contact and open body language, to make others feel at ease. Additionally, addressing each person with respect, regardless of age, gender, ethnicity, or background, fosters an inclusive and respectful atmosphere.

    4. Embracing Diversity and Inclusion

    A welcoming environment is one that embraces diversity and makes everyone feel like they belong. This can be achieved by celebrating cultural differences and honoring various perspectives. Simple gestures, like showcasing diverse artwork or celebrating cultural events, signal to people that diversity is valued. Establishing policies and practices that prevent discrimination and promote equal opportunities helps foster a space where everyone feels respected and included. Additionally, offering diverse food options, especially for events, demonstrates respect for different dietary preferences and cultural backgrounds.

    5. Clear and Open Communication

    Effective communication is key to a welcoming environment. Ensuring that people know what to expect and providing them with clear guidelines on behavior, policies, or event schedules makes a space feel organized and trustworthy. Open communication also involves being approachable and open to feedback, creating a safe space where individuals can voice their needs, opinions, and concerns. This can be achieved by offering suggestion boxes, hosting feedback sessions, or providing contact information for further inquiries.

    6. Flexibility and Adaptability

    Creating a welcoming environment requires an understanding that each individual has unique needs. Being flexible and adaptable, whether it’s allowing for remote participation, adjusting room layouts, or offering flexible seating arrangements, can go a long way in making people feel comfortable. This flexibility also means being responsive to the changing needs of the community and regularly assessing the environment to make necessary improvements.

    7. Safety and Security

    Safety is a fundamental component of a welcoming environment. This includes physical safety, such as secure entrances, adequate lighting, and emergency exits, as well as emotional safety. People need to feel safe from judgment, harassment, or discrimination, and organizations should have policies in place to address these issues promptly and effectively.

    Conclusion

    A welcoming environment is more than just a nice space—it’s a combination of physical comfort, respect, accessibility, and inclusivity. By prioritizing these elements, any space can become a place where individuals feel valued and at home. Whether it’s a community center, workplace, or gathering space, creating a welcoming environment ultimately helps foster connections, support, and mutual respect among all who enter.
